Internal vs External WiFi Antenna Comparison

Feature Internal Antenna External Antenna
Integration Embedded inside device Mounted externally
Signal Stability High (shielded design) High (adjustable direction)
Installation Compact design Flexible placement
Application TV / IoT / automotive Router / base station

Internal antennas are widely used in VLG’s embedded TV modules and IoT devices where space efficiency is critical.

WiFi Antenna Development Process at VLG

VLG follows a structured RF engineering workflow to ensure performance consistency.

Step-by-step process:

  1. Requirement Definition
    Define frequency band, gain, size, and application
  2. RF Simulation
    Model radiation performance using antenna simulation tools
  3. Prototype Development
    Build early-stage RF antenna samples
  4. Chamber Testing
    Validate performance in anechoic chambers
  5. Mass Production
    Controlled under IATF 16949 quality system
  6. Device Integration Support
    Optimize antenna placement for real devices

This ensures each wifi antenna performs reliably in real-world environments.
